Listen "Does the 'centre ground' exist? "
Episode Synopsis
The 'centre ground' is the most overused and imprecise term in British politics. Cameron, Osborne and Blair claim to be on 'the centre ground'. So do most political columnists. But what if these economic liberals are nowhere near the centre ground... if it exists at all?
